Every college basketball team is entitled to an off night a couple times a season. For Virginia Tech tonight, it was even more understandable.
Not having played since Feb. 6 (an overtime win against Miami), the Hokies showed the rust from their long layoff. Two opponent postponements and then a pair of games pushed back due to their own coronavirus testing protocols, and Mike Young's team was simply rusty.
